What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(11): Each employee on a steep roof with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els was not protected from falling by guardrail systems with toeboards,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ems:  On or about October 4, 2016, at the above addressed job site, employees were exposed to falls of up to 18 feet while performing roof construction while walking on steep roofs without a means of fall protection.

29 CFR 1926.20(b)(2): The employer did not initiate and maintain programs which provided for frequent and regular inspections of the job site, materials and equipment to be made by a competent person(s)  On or about October 4, 2016, at the above addressed job site, the employer did not ensure that frequent and regular inspections of the worksite were conducted to ensure that employees had been using adequate fall protection systems while performing roofing construction as employees had slack lifelines and did not have sufficient number of anchorages.
